You will notice that, as in a score board, the college basketball gambling line is situated so that the home team is on the bottom while the away team is at the top. To the immediate right of each team is the money line. This is a number, usually like -150 or +170 that is the odds of a team winning expressed as a payout ratio. The money line is located to the immediate right of the team on the college basketball gambling line. Bookmakers calculate the number for each team. The team that bookmakers expect to win is the negative number while the positive number denotes the underdog. Basically, if you bet on a team that is given -150, that means for every $150 you bet, you win $100 plus your bet back if the team you bet on beats the spread. On the other hand, if you bet $100 on a +170 team, you win $170 plus your $100 bet back if your team beats the spread.

The spread is another important piece of information on the college basketball gambling line. The spread is the number of points that the winning team is expected to win by. Say the spread is 10 points. If team A is favored to win by ten points, then they need to win by at least 11 points for you to win any money. If they win by exactly 10 points, you have pushed with the house and no money changes hands. If they win but by less then 10 points, that means team B has beaten the spread and, if you bet on team A, you lose your bet.

Finally, the college basketball gambling line will include information on the total. The total is the total number of points bookmakers expect to be scored in the game. You can bet with the house that the actual total will be over or under this amount. If the total points scored in the game is exactly the amount listed on the college basketball gambling line, then you have pushed with the house and no money changes hands.
